the depth of a rain puddle d(t) is given in inches, and t is given in minutes. if the depth is changing with respect to time, which expression gives the rate at which the depth of the water is changing at 3 minutes? g

1 Answer

6 votes

Final answer:

The expression for the rate of change of depth at 3 minutes is given by d'(3).

Step-by-step explanation:

The rate at which the depth of the rain puddle is changing with respect to time can be expressed using the derivative. Let d(t) be the depth of the puddle at time t. The expression for the rate of change of depth at 3 minutes is given by:

d'(3)
